I've gotten an opportunity to review some of piCture pOlish shades so from now on the Mondays will be dedicated to them. If you don't already know, piCture pOlish is an Australian brand that brings many unique shades and it's sister brand is only freaking Ozotic! First polish I'll review is Dorothy...




Dorothy - strawberry red jelly base with magenta and silver glitter. It's a very pretty shade and I think it is great for Summer! I love how some of the glitter is half-sinked in the jelly base so it appears coloured. The finish is very sparkly in the sun and the polish looks gorgeous on toes.

The formula is opaque in two coats and it applied very well. It also dried fast but gritty so I needed a thick topcoat like Seche to smooth out the surface. Because it's glitter it lasted on me four days without chipping so good result :)

What about some indie swatches today? I have here three pretty Darling Diva polishes that I'm sure you'll enjoy :)

Holiday - multicoloured round glitter in a clear base. I've applied one coat of Holiday over Barielle Banana Drop. Some of the glitters are quite big so I needed to play around with the placement. It applied well and dried fast but I needed an extra coat of topcoat to smooth out the surface.

Material Girl - pink jelly with pink, magenta and silver holographic glitter.So pretty and girly shade! The formula is a bit sheer because of its jelly base so I needed three thicker coats for full coverage. It applied well but I did have to play a little with the glitter placement. I've applied topcoat to smooth out the surface.

Bitchcraft - dark grey jelly base packed with holographic particles and duochrome glitter. I love this polish so much! Not only does it have such a cool name that makes me giggle but it is also absolutely stunning! It might seem like regular holo in the sun but when you get into shade the duochrome glitter (just like in Ozotic Elytra) shows itself and creates an interesting colour. I have applied one coat of Bitchcreaft *giggle* over A England Camelot. The polish by itself is on the sheer side so I would need maybe three thick coats for dark colour. Layering is much better option. It applied well, dried fast and gritty so I'm wearing topcoat as well.

Bring On The Night - black jelly base with emerald green glitter and with just a hint of magenta specks. I find the shade quite unique as usually I see black base paired with blue or red glitter. The polish itself is not very opaque and I think I would need three thicker coats for full coverage so I've layered it. I've applied one coat over A England Camelot. Application was easy and the polish dried fast.

Effervescent - warm orange jelly base with blue iridescent particles and pearl white glitter. Imagine warm beach sand, sea and sunset...that's what I think of when I see this polish. The orange has red undertones making it really warm and pretty. It has white pearl glitter that is coloured by the orange jelly. I'm wearing two thicker coats.

Once More, With Feeling - lavender blue sheer jelly with magenta shimmer and white and pink square glitter. Another pretty combination for the lovers of blue shades. It applied very easily and I'm wearing two thicker coats. They dried average to fast but a bit gritty so I needed to apply topcoat.

All three polishes had nice formula but were a little bit sheerer than I would have expected. Each bottle of Cadillacquer has 15ml and black ridged cap that makes opening the bottles easy.

I've got some more awesome Shimmer polishes to show you! Shimmer polish is well-known for its pretty glitter bombs and I am always amazed to see more and more amazing combinations! So here they are:

Karen - purple, blue, silver and holo glitter in a lightly tinted base. Karen is girly purple with flashes of blue glitter and looks great layered over pinks and purples. I have applied one coat over Dermelect Moxie. The glitter density is very nice but not dense enough for full coverage in two coats. It dries fast but I needed topcoat to smooth the surface.
